Can true Autumns wear black?

True Autumns can wear black, but it’s not their most flattering color. While black is a staple in many wardrobes, True Autumns often look best in warmer, earthy tones. Let’s explore why this is and how True Autumns can incorporate black into their outfits effectively.

What Colors Suit True Autumns Best?

True Autumns are characterized by warm, rich hues that mirror the colors of autumn leaves. These individuals typically have warm undertones in their skin, hair, and eyes. The best colors for True Autumns include:

  • Earthy Browns: Think of rich chocolate and chestnut shades.
  • Warm Greens: Olive and moss green complement their warm undertones.
  • Deep Reds: Brick red and rust are ideal choices.
  • Golden Yellows: Mustard and ochre enhance their natural warmth.
  • Warm Oranges: Pumpkin and burnt orange are perfect for True Autumns.

These colors enhance the natural warmth of True Autumns, creating a harmonious and flattering look.

Can True Autumns Wear Black?

While black is a classic color, it can sometimes overpower the warm, muted palette of True Autumns. Here are some tips for wearing black if you’re a True Autumn:

  • Use Black as an Accent: Incorporate black in small doses, such as accessories or shoes, rather than as the main color.
  • Pair with Warm Tones: Combine black with one of your best colors, like a warm brown or deep red, to soften the contrast.
  • Choose Softer Blacks: Opt for charcoal or a faded black, which can be less harsh against your warm complexion.

How to Incorporate Black into a True Autumn Wardrobe

True Autumns can still enjoy wearing black by strategically integrating it into their wardrobe. Here are some practical examples:

  1. Layering: Wear a black jacket over a warm-toned top to balance the look.
  2. Accessories: Use black in belts, bags, or shoes to add depth without overwhelming your outfit.
  3. Patterns: Choose clothing with black in the pattern, mixed with autumn colors.

Why Warm Colors Work Best for True Autumns

The warm colors of the True Autumn palette reflect the natural hues found in autumn landscapes. These colors:

  • Enhance Skin Tone: Warm colors complement the golden undertones in True Autumn skin, making it look healthier and more vibrant.
  • Create Harmony: The colors blend seamlessly with the natural coloring of True Autumns, creating a cohesive look.
  • Provide Contrast: Against the natural warmth, these colors provide enough contrast without being too stark.

What Colors Should True Autumns Avoid?

True Autumns should generally avoid cool, icy colors like blue and gray, which can wash out their warm complexion. Pastels and neon colors can also be unflattering, as they clash with the natural warmth of a True Autumn palette.

Can True Autumns Wear White?

True Autumns can wear white, but they should opt for warmer whites like ivory or cream. These shades are less stark than pure white and complement the warm tones of a True Autumn.

What Makeup Colors Suit True Autumns?

True Autumns should choose makeup with warm undertones. Earthy browns, golden hues, and warm reds work well for eyeshadows and lipsticks. Avoid cool-toned makeup, which can create an unflattering contrast.

How Can True Autumns Transition from Summer to Autumn Wardrobes?

To transition from summer to autumn, True Autumns can gradually incorporate deeper and warmer shades into their wardrobe. Layering lighter summer pieces with autumnal colors can ease the transition. Consider adding accessories like scarves or hats in autumn colors.
